site stats

Db2 insert into with a cte

WebDb2 11 - Db2 SQL - common-table-expression common-table-expression A common table expression defines a result table with table-identifier that can be referenced in any FROM clause of the fullselect that follows. Multiple common table expressions can be specified following the single WITH keyword. WebSep 23, 2024 · The Common Table Expressions (CTE) were introduced into standard SQL in order to simplify various classes of SQL Queries for which a derived table was just unsuitable. CTE was introduced in SQL Server 2005, the common table expression (CTE) is a temporary named result set that you can reference within a SELECT, INSERT, …

Can I use a CTE with MERGE - Forums - IBM Support

WebMay 14, 2013 · All I want to do is make a Created Global Temp Table (CGTT) and append data to it. The same code below will work if I use a Declared Global Temp Table, but for my purposes I must have a CGTT. CREATE GLOBAL TEMPORARY TABLE TEST_TBL ( KEY_ID BIGINT, SOMETEXT VARCHAR (10) ); INSERT INTO USERID.TEST_TBL … WebWhen to use DB2 CTE. You can use a common table expression in the following scenarios: When you want to avoid creating views for reference in an SQL statement. When the … chopstick clothing https://gr2eng.com

Db2 11 - Db2 SQL - common-table-expression - IBM

WebJan 31, 2024 · A recursive common table expression can be used to write a query that walks a tree or graph. A recursive common table expression has the same basic syntax as an ordinary common table expression, but with the following additional attributes: The "select-stmt" must be a compound select. That is to say, the CTE body must be two or … WebApr 13, 2024 · Solution 2: It seems that you already have some data in dbo.taradod, and while inserting new data from @taradodType you want to filter out rows which are already exists in dbo.taradod. You can try select query like this: SELECT * FROM @taradodType t1 left outer join dbo.taradod t2 on t1.IDP = t2.IDP and t1.date = t2.date where t2.IDP is null. WebA common table expression name can only be referenced in the select-statement, SELECT INTO statement, INSERT statement, CREATE VIEW statement, or RETURN statement … chopstick cleaner

Can I use a CTE with MERGE - Forums - IBM Support

Category:Db2 CTE or Common Table Expression By Examples

Tags:Db2 insert into with a cte

Db2 insert into with a cte

Cannot Insert SQL Into One Specific Table

WebDB2 INSERT statement helps us to insert the rows or values of a column in a particular table or view that is present in database while using DB2 RDBMS. Maintaining the database requires storing a lot of values in the database. Most of the times, the data is stored in the format of rows and columns in table. In DB2 relational database, data is ... WebMar 13, 2024 · 作为一名数据分析师,熟练掌握 mysql 数据库是非常重要的,以下是一些你需要学习的 mysql 技能: 1. sql语句的基本操作:了解sql语句的基本语法,例如select、insert、update和delete等命令,掌握查询数据的方法,理解sql语句的条件、聚合函数等常见 …

Db2 insert into with a cte

Did you know?

WebMay 10, 2016 · Note:- Also before this update query i'm using the same CTE in an INSERT statement as well. Monday, May 2, 2016 7:40 AM. ... DECLARE @someTable TABLE (ID INT IDENTITY, value INT) INSERT INTO @someTable (value) VALUES (1),(2),(3),(4) ;WITH existingValues AS ( SELECT * FROM @someTable ), newValues AS ( SELECT 1 …

WebThe Db2 INSERT statement allows you to insert multiple rows into a table using the following syntax: INSERT INTO table_name (column_list) VALUES (value_list_1), (value_list_2), (value_list_3), ...; Code language: SQL (Structured Query Language) (sql) To insert multiple rows into a table, you need to: WebMay 26, 2024 · DB2 SQL TABLE EXPRESSION SQL TABLE EXPRESSION gives you the power to create a temporary table inside a query. The life of this temporary table is only inside that query. As soon as the query is...

WebJul 25, 2024 · You can insert directly like: INSERT INTO T_STORAGE (CUSTOMER_ID, ORDER_ID) WITH TEMP1 AS ( SELECT CUSTOMER_ID FROM T_CUSTOMER WHERE CUSTOMER_ID BETWEEN 100 AND 300 ), TEMP2 AS ( SELECT CUSTOMER_ID, ORDER_ID FROM TEMP1 T1 JOIN T_ORDER R1 ON T1.CUSTOMER_ID = … WebFirst, specify the name of the table to which you want to insert a new row after the INSERT INTO keywords followed by comma-separated column list enclosed in …

WebMar 17, 2024 · DB2 Insert from CTE I have a query using a CTE WITH CTE_RESULTS AS ( SELECT kp.*, db.ID, 1 AS count FROM TABLE1 kp -- 7,285 INNER JOIN TABLE2 cb …

WebDec 7, 2016 · DB2 v8 insert with CTE. I need to select from a CTE (common table expression) in DB2 v8 and insert the result into a table. The relevant documentation for v8 is hard to understand at first glance, but for v9 there's a clear example ( … chopstick cityWebDec 20, 2016 · IBM DB2 Answer Select Data > New Data Source and choose your desired data source. In the Server Connection dialog box, choose Initial SQL. Enter your CTE in the Initial SQL field. The example below uses a recursive self-join on 'Employees' table to build out an employee reporting hierarchy using a common table expression named … great british nuclear budgetWebSep 28, 2024 · A common table expression i.e CTE which is used to the specific temporary result set by using SELECT, INSERT, UPDATE, or DELETE statement. So the user can do further operations on it. When the user uses joins queries on some particular table & in sub-queries, he needs the same set of records then code readability is … chop-stick comicWebOct 29, 2010 · The second CTE is defined right after the first CTE, using the same WITH clause, by placing a comma after the first CTE. Once both CTEs are defined, an easy to read SELECT statement references each CTE. In this case, I joined the output of each CTE based on SalesPersonID. great british nuclear ceoWebJan 11, 2012 · Once we INSERT records into the table variable, we can reference it in other queries almost as if it were a table. The data in the CTE, on the other hand, ceases to exist outside the query... chop stick clip artWebDec 20, 2016 · For IBM DB2: DECLARE GLOBAL TEMPORARY TABLE SESSION.ctedemo (ID int, Name varchar (50), Level int, ManagerID int) on commit … chopstick city indoreWebJan 29, 2024 · INSERT INTO tbAlmondData SELECT * FROM tbAlmondData_Winter_DropTable Since we saved all the data we removed in full within this backup table, we can do a full insert to restore the … great british nuclear gbn